The Mechanics Behind Increased Traffic Enforcement

At its core, the Mt Pleasant Sheriff's Office Cracking Down on Traffic Violations in Charleston County involves a combination of traditional patrol methods and modern technology. Officers may use handheld radar devices, LIDAR systems, or in-vehicle speed detection tools to monitor traffic flow and identify unsafe behaviors. These tools help law enforcement gather objective data, which can be used both for immediate intervention and long-term planning. The initiative often follows a structured process that begins with identifying high-risk corridors or patterns, followed by increased presence during peak hours. By focusing on verifiable infractions, the office aims to create a consistent and fair approach that applies equally to all road users.

Examining the Pros and Cons for Different Stakeholders

From a practical standpoint, there are clear advantages to a focused enforcement campaign, including improved compliance and potentially fewer severe accidents. Drivers may benefit from more predictable road conditions and a greater sense that rules are being applied consistently. However, there are also considerations to weigh, such as the possibility of increased fines for residents and visitors or concerns about the allocation of law enforcement resources. Some argue that camera-based or highly visible enforcement can create a perception of revenue generation rather than genuine safety efforts. Acknowledging both sides of the discussion helps maintain a balanced perspective and supports informed decision-making.
